a question about those hid's: Don't you lose your high-beams if you put the HID kit in?

Yes you will loose the high beam unless you buy an HID kit with low/high beam but that's over 1000 dollars.

The Maxima uses the same bulb for high/low beam.
The VW golf for example has 4 lights 2 for low and 2 for high so then you can put an HID kit for the low beams and still have the high beam.
